LED Forward Voltage

The forward voltage of an LED is the voltage required to make it conduct electricity and emit light. For 3mm LEDs, the forward voltage is usually measured at a forward current of 20mA. This value is important for designers and engineers as it helps them select the appropriate power supply and circuit design. It is also essential for ensuring that the LED operates within its specified parameters.

LED Current Regulation

To maintain consistent brightness and prevent damage, it is necessary to regulate the current flowing through a 3mm LED. This is typically achieved using a constant current driver, which ensures that the LED receives a steady flow of current regardless of the voltage fluctuations. The driver's output voltage must be compatible with the LED's forward voltage to prevent overheating and excessive power consumption.

Applications of 3mm LEDs

3mm LEDs are versatile and find applications in a wide range of industries. Some common uses include: - Indicator lights in electronic devices - Display modules in digital clocks and meters - Decorative lighting in architectural and landscape projects - Medical devices and instrumentation - Automotive lighting and indicators
